The MBA Program

Who?

481 participants
51 nationalities represented on campus, > 80 % international
Age: 30, generally 3-7 years professional experience (average 6 years)

Length:

The HEC MBA Program offers a solid generalist management education that opens new international job opportunities.

  • Full-time: 16 months design allows for personal and professional growth, with time to analyze future goals and learn new skills. 2 intakes, January and September
  • Part-time: the modular design allows students to customize their curriculum and earn their MBA in an average of 24 months. This program is custom made for high-potential young managers who want to maintain professional activity while raising their careers to an international level.


  • Why are MBAs prepared for Success?*

    HEC MBAs benefit from a solid foundation of management courses. Designed to develop comprehensive core management knowledge and techniques, this aspect of the program is designed to be very academically demanding.
    Participants also receive training in cross-cultural understanding, group dynamics, team-building and ethics.

    Full-time employment:

    MBAs are available beginning in January (September intake) or May (January intake)

    Corporate projects:

    Mid-April to early-September (September intake) or January to April (January intake)

    HEC MBA participants can be hired for various corporate projects. Participants remain in close contact with HEC faculty for the duration of the 4-5 month project period.

    . Company Consulting Project (CCP)
    Participants join companies as strategic consultants (in teams of 2-3).

    . Individual Professional Project (IPP)
    Faculty and company managers mentor participants during 4-5 month projects. Participants attend executive seminars on-campus before and after.

    . Mission & Action Project (MAP)
    An opportunity to work toward a humanitarian goal, engage in fieldwork, sharpen business skills while aiding the community.

    . Creative Academic Project (CAP)
    A business case is developed with faculty and directly with company executives to find solutions to business issues.

    . Summer project (July to August)
    Independent internships for 2.5 months.
